CFT-6660: Families and AddictionThis course will provide an understanding of the structure and dynamics of marriage and other committed relationships, and families affected by addiction. The course will review theoretical perspectives of families and addiction through a systemic lens. Students will explore assessments and interventions through various family therapy approaches including behavioral, structural, strategic, and Bowenian therapy. Min.
